Here is a list of the features you will want your CRM software to have:

Customer relationship management is the most important feature when it comes to any small business CRM solution. You will need a system that has all of the tools necessary for you to manage your customers and retain your customers. You will be able to reach out to your customers with emails, phone calls, and even virtual visits. All of these methods are great for keeping in touch with your customers.

You will also want a CRM that provides you with the ability to track all of your leads and sales. You will want to know who is calling you and how you are converting them into customers. You will also want to know who is not calling you and how you are connecting with them via email and phone calls. Tracking this information will allow you to grow your business much faster. Your software should also provide you with the ability to compare your leads to your sales in order to see which ones are working and which ones are not working.

Franchise CRM software should provide you with the ability to build customer loyalty by having the ability to recommend additional products and services to your existing customers.
